Resting With Rudolph
Resting in the park bench,
Old Santa Claus I saw,
With Rudolph the reindeer,
The cold trying to thaw;
Looking tired and worn,
Old Santa Claus sat there,
Musing on his next move,
With so less time to spare;
Sitting in the soft snow,
Old Santa Claus took time,
After his gifts were spent,
Enjoying the cool clime;
Resting in the park bench,
Old Santa Claus I saw,
With Rudolph the reindeer,
Who was resting his paw.
